—— Books ——

Ceremonies of the Heart: Celebrating lesbian unions edited by Becky Butler (1990), $14.95 +$2.24 p&h, Seal Press, 3131 Western Ave., #410, Seattle, WA 98121-1028; 206-283-7844. Couples describe 27 ceremonies and their relationships.

Daring to Speak Love’s Name: A gay & lesbian prayer book by Dr. Elizabeth Stuart (1992), $10, Hamish Hamilton - London; distributed by Penguin Books, 375 Hudson St., New York, NY 10014. Prayers for celebrating relationships, coming out; partings, healing liturgies and deaths.

The Essential Guide to Lesbian and Gay Weddings by Tess Ayers and Paul Brown (1994), $17, Harper San Francisco (HarperCollins, 10 East 53 St., New York, NY 10022). From Affidavit of domestic partnership to Vichud (seclusion tradition); the minutia of ceremonial wedding events and how to plan for them.

In God’s Image: Christian Witness to the Need for Gay/Lesbian Equality in the Eyes of the Church by Robert Warren Cromey (1991), $9.95, Alamo Square Press, Box 14543, San Francisco, CA 94114. Episcopal priest agues for same-sex marriage.

In Praise of Gay Marriage (1986), biblical tracts #4-7, 10 cents ea., $1.50 min. order +$1.50 p&h, Puget Sound Publishing Group, 3401 Rucker, East Suite, Everett, WA 98201, 206-339-8338. Contends that Jesus and John were married.

Lesbian & Gay Marriage: Private commitments, public ceremonies edited by Suzanne Sherman (1992), $16.95, Temple University Press, Philadelphia PA 19122. Essays on ceremonial marriage and 24 interviews focused on why the couples married or chose not to. Includes an article from Partners Task Force directors.

Living in Sin? by John Shelby Spong (1988), $15.95, Harper & Row, Icehouse One, #401, 151 Union St., San Francisco, CA 94111. Includes arguments for blessing same-sex relationships.

Recognizing Ourselves: Ceremonies of Lesbian and Gay Commitment by Ellen Lewin (1998) $17/paper $30/hard, Columbia University Press, New York. Includes analysis of the symbolic strategies same-sex couples use in devising their ceremonies; lengthy excerpts from many different kinds of ceremonies, and extensive narrative material from couples.

Report on the Task Force on Changing Patterns of Sexuality and Family Life, Send SASE with $.65 postage to Episcopal Diocese of Newark, 24 Rector St., Newark, NJ 07102. Endorses homosexual marriage.

Resource Guide for Same-Sex Couples (1988); In the Presence of God … A Quaker Marriage (1988), $5.50 for both, Family Relations Committee, Friends Center, 1515 Cherry St., Philadelphia, PA 19102. Helps couples and meetings prepare for the vows of marriage.

Same-Sex Unions in Premodern Europe by John Boswell (1994), $25, Villard Books (Random House), 201 E. 50th St., New York, NY 10022; 800-733-3000. Newly rediscovered liturgies from early Catholic and Orthodox, used throughout Christendom into modern times; contextualized in a detailed, academic treatment.

The Two of Us by Larry J. Uhrig, OUT OF PRINT, Alyson Publications, Boston, MA. MCC pastor’s approach to same-sex marriage.
